Create a Budget

Creating a budget is the first step you should take. First, make sure you have a plan for paying off the debts, if you have any. Next, create a “survival plan” for the current month. Create categories of your priorities and spend accordingly.

See What You Already Own

Can you honestly say you don’t own anything that still has a tag on? Before you continue shopping, make sure you know exactly what you have and what you need. Don’t just buy things aimlessly, because they are on sale or they look cute in the store. Create outfits in advance, either in your head or with your camera, and only buy what you’re missing.

You Don’t Have to Own Every Single Trendy Piece

You really don’t need hundreds of dresses or shoes in your wardrobe. Also, there’s absolutely no reason for you to have a new wardrobe every season. Trends change so fast for a reason – for you to shop more. Instead, find your own style and start investing in pieces that will last you for many years.

Emotional Shopping is a Problem

Do you go shopping when you’re feeling down? We know new clothes can make you instantly happier but that only lasts for a couple of hours. Once you get home, you forget about your new stuff and just want to go shopping again. It’s a vicious circle. Try only going shopping when you are in a good mood.
